What is the diameter of a US golf ball?

1.680 in
Under the rules of golf, a golf ball has a mass no more than 1.620 oz (45.93 grams), has a diameter not less than 1.680 in (42.67 mm), and performs within specified velocity, distance, and symmetry limits.

Are American golf balls bigger?

The oh-so-slightly larger ball played in USGA-governed areas became known as the “American ball,” while the smaller ball golfers in R&A areas had the option to use was known as the “small ball,” “British ball” or “British Open ball.” (And for good measure, it was occasionally called the “European ball.”)

Are bigger golf balls legal?

Turns out there isn’t a rule on how LARGE a golf ball can be, there is only a rule about how SMALL it can be – so as long as a golf ball is at least 1.68 inches in diameter, it is legal.

Do smaller golf balls go further?

The smaller ball known as the “Small Ball” or “British Ball” was an option for golfers playing under R&A rules. Although the difference in size sounds minimal it had a significant impact on the flight of the ball with the smaller version flying farther and straighter than the larger version.

What was the minimum size of a golf ball in the 1930s?

The R&A approved golf balls with minimum diameters of 1.62 inches in the early 1900s. But in the early 1930s, the USGA ruled against those smaller balls, sticking with a minimum diameter of 1.68 inches.

When did the USGA stop using small golf balls?

The difference in minimum golf ball diameter was one of the last major disagreements between the R&A and USGA that was codified in the rules. The R&A took the first step in 1974, when it decided the small ball could no longer be used in the British Open.
